Ellise Gitas is an independent American singer-songwriter. She moved to Los Angeles in October 2015, where she gained attention by posting covers on her Youtube channel, beginning with "Hello" by Adele and released her first single, "Dominoes", on July 7, 2016.[1]
Biography
Ellise Gitas was born on September 10, 1998, in Danville, California. When she was 17 years old, she decided to move to Los Angeles to pursue a career as a professional singer and recording artist, stating that “I wanted to pursue singing as a career, and L.A. is the place you go to do that.”[2] Before moving to Los Angeles, she was required to finish high school and was able to graduate two years early by passing a graduation exam.[3] Shortly after her arrival in Los Angeles, she began recording and posting covers to Youtube, beginning with her cover of Adele's "Hello".
After her initial release, she posted songs to Youtube on a weekly basis and attained a following of over 10,000 subscribers. She then posted her first original single and music video, "Dominos", which was directed by Paul Boyd on July 7, 2016. On July 17, she performed at her first major concert in Luna Park.[4] She has also stated that she is directing all of her attention towards releasing an EP in 2016.[5]
